Poppy

You can notice them all year long, but you will find a whole bunch of poppies in October/November. Everywhere. On the companies’ nametags. on shirts and sweaters. Even cars… These little poppy-shaped pins are very important to the British people. It is a symbol of commemoration (that took a lot of importance after World War I). We wear it to remember the casualties. Respect of veterans and dead in action is definitely more important than in France. Don’t miss it even if History is not my cup of tea. The British won’t appreciate… So go to the supermarket and buy one.
